Berlin businesswoman charged over alleged spying for Russia

Europe 1 source 1 country 🔦 Under-reported 5m ago

Federal prosecutors in Germany have charged a Berlin-based marketing executive with acting as an intelligence agent for Russia. Authorities allege that the woman leveraged her professional network of political and military contacts to facilitate access for a Russian intelligence officer seeking to infiltrate influential German circles.

The charges center on the defendant's alleged efforts to gather sensitive information regarding German defense policy. The case highlights ongoing concerns regarding foreign intelligence activities within Germany and the potential exploitation of professional networks to gain access to high-level policy discussions.
